.detailpanel_detail__X7mYi{font-family:"Noto Serif";font-size:14px;font-style:normal;font-weight:400;line-height:normal;color:var(--txt-04)}.detailpanel_detail__X7mYi h2{position:relative;display:flex;align-items:center;justify-content:center;text-align:left;font-size:1.25rem;font-weight:900}.detailpanel_detail__X7mYi h2,.detailpanel_detail__X7mYi h3{color:var(--txt-04);font-style:normal;line-height:22px;letter-spacing:-1px}.detailpanel_detail__X7mYi h3{font-size:1.125rem;font-weight:700}.detailpanel_detail__X7mYi h4{color:var(--txt-04);font-size:14px;font-style:normal;font-weight:700;line-height:normal}@media (min-width:1024px){.detailpanel_detail__X7mYi h2{font-size:1.5rem;line-height:33px;text-align:center}.detailpanel_detail__X7mYi h4{font-size:1rem}}.detailpanel_detail__X7mYi ol,.detailpanel_detail__X7mYi ul{padding-left:2em;display:flex;flex-direction:column;gap:12px}.detailpanel_detail__X7mYi ul{list-style:disc}.detailpanel_detail__X7mYi ol{list-style:decimal}.detailpanel_detail__X7mYi a{color:var(--others-01-prem)}.detailpanel_detail__X7mYi a:hover{text-decoration:underline}.tarot_tarot__uxSnF{background:#2d2334;z-index:0}.tarot_maskLayer__te9hz{z-index:200}.tarot_mainLayer__sKhOT{z-index:100}.tarot_lightRaysLayer__Zc2d4{z-index:20}.tarot_sceneLayer__QTXDl{z-index:10}.tarot_sceneHandLayer__4BqE2{z-index:20}.tarot_cornerDecorationLayer__6ZNh0{z-index:210}.tarot_deckLayer__ItjQL{z-index:50}.tarot_deckContentLayer__NmdiU{z-index:220}.tarot_tarotBorder__7LZIO{border:.5px solid #fff9f3}.tarot_tarotReshuffle__Fkz8y{background:var(
    ---tarot-btn,linear-gradient(101deg,#dcb945 15.98%,#c09234 90.75%)
  );background-clip:text;-webkit-background-clip:text;-webkit-text-fill-color:transparent}.tarot_tarotText__Q4nrj{font-family:var(--font-noto,"Noto serif");font-weight:500;text-align:center;font-size:clamp(24px,4vw,54px)}.tarot_tarotTextLG__RG3yY,.tarot_tarotText__Q4nrj{background:linear-gradient(180deg,#f8efd1 28.74%,#c09234 87.93%);background-clip:text;-webkit-background-clip:text;-webkit-text-fill-color:transparent}.tarot_tarotInputWrap__kgS54{display:flex;height:60px;padding:5px 5px 5px 16px;justify-content:space-between;align-items:center;align-self:stretch;border-radius:30px;border:1px solid #fce5cd;background:var(--bg-input,rgba(255,255,255,.1));backdrop-filter:blur(5px)}.tarot_tarotInput__HPW2Z{flex:1;width:100%;height:100%;background:transparent;border:none;outline:none}